On the other hand, Gold shows large relativistic effects (the Gold maximum — see eg. [21]). In fact, it has been explicitly demonstrated that for Au relativistic and arc-effects are nonadditive [22]. This is most obvious for its electron affinity While a nonrelativistic Cl-calculation [23] gives a value of 1.02 eV and a fully relativistic Coupled-Cluster calculation [22] yields 2.28 eV, the corresponding nonrelativistic and relativistic Hartree-Fock values are 0.10 eV [22] and 0.67 eV, respectively. This destabilization may lead, in turn, to an indirect stabilization of the next higher s and p shells with spatial extent similar to the d shell in question. This situation occurs in the case of the late transition metals and leads to the gold maximum of relativistic effects and the unusually large relativistic effects in the elements of groups 10-12. If the d shell is only weakly occupied, as is the case in the early transition metals, the direct effect on the s and p shells is partly balanced by the indirect effect on those shells, and the relativistic effects are generally much smaller. [Pg.90]

Element 112 is the heaviest element discovered so far, with a half-life of approximately 240 ps for isotope 277. With a closed shell electron configuration of [Rn]5f 6s 6p 6d 7s element 112 is the last member of the fourth series of transition elements. The ratio of (r>R to (r>NR for the 7s orbital of element 112 is the smallest of all the seventh row elements suggesting that the gold maximum of relativistic effects may move from Group 11 to Group 12 in the fourth series of transition elements. Possible tape materials include polyimide, polyester, polyethersulfone (PES), and polyparabanic acid (PPA) (18). Of these, polyimide is the most widely used material because its high melting point allows it to survive at temperatures up to 365°C. Although polyester is much cheaper than other materials, its use is limited to temperatures less than 160°C. PES and PPA, on the other hand, are half as cosdy as polyimide, and can survive maximum short-term temperatures of 220 and 275°C, respectively. PES has better dimensional stabiUty than polyimide, absorbs less moisture, and does not tear as easily however, it is inflammable and can be attacked by certain common solvents. Silicon is soluble in aluminum in the solid state to a maximum of 1.62 wt % at 577°C (2). It is soluble in silver, gold, and 2inc at temperatures above their melting points. Phase diagrams of systems containing silicides are available (2,3). [Pg.535]

Urokinase (from human urine) [9039-53-6] Mr 53,000, [EC 3.4.21.31]. Crystn of this enzyme is induced at pH 5.0 to 5.3 (4") by careful addition of NaCl with gentle stirring until the soln becomes turbid (silky sheen). The NaCl concentration is increased gradually (over several days) until 98% of saturation is achieved whereby the urokinase crystallises as colourless thin brittle plates. Bursting discs may be fabricated of gold, silver, platinum or palladium. The recommended maximum temperatures for continuous use are 80 C for gold, 150 C for silver, 300 C for palladium and 450 C for platinum. Let us consider first the low-energy fission of the lighter fissionable elements, in the neighborhood of Pb208. These elements (gold, thallium, lead, bismuth), when bombarded with particles such as 20-Mev deuterons, undergo symmetric fission, the distribution function of the products having a half width at half maximum of 8 to 15 mass-number units (20). [Pg.822]

Along the same lines it was advocated that colors be read at the absorption maximum rather than at some other convenient point. An example of this is the increase in absorbance one obtains when analyzing for bromide by means of gold chloride (18). As can be seen from Figure 14, the peak with gold bromide increases by a factor of more than 2 when the color is extracted into octanol and read at its absorption maximum (18). [Pg.113]
